Back when wardriving was a more popular pastime (and before the ISM bands got clogged completely up with everything), I wanted to play around more with long-range 802.11b/g signals.

I scored an old Primestar dish and LNBF. This was the easy part: I just talked to one of the guys at a small local company that dealt with things like consumer satellite, and asked nice. He was curious what I wanted to use it for (Primestar was dead by that point), so I told him, and he thought that was a fun idea so he gave me one or two that he had kicking around in the shop.

The idea was to toss the LNBF and put a biquad antenna made from wire at just the right spot where the parabola focused. It seemed easy enough, but my fabrication skills 20 years ago were lacking, and I didn't have any measurement gear beyond a multimeter and a tape measure, so the project never went anywhere.

But nowadays, with modern accessible CAD and 3D printing and sendcutsend and JLC and SDR dongles and Harbor Freight and everything else? With the RF gear I either own these days, or have access to? Yeah, I'd probably be able to make it work. I might even be able to turn a new feedhorn on my buddy's lathe to increase efficiency. FFS, there's probably already parametric models out there for OpenSCAD that just do this thing.

It seems much, much more do-able with today's resources than it was back then.

Can't it be done with a DLP device? CRT was X-ray projection device with phosphor paint applied inside to convert the rays to visible light.

CRTs were emitting an electron beam to draw images on a phosphorescent screen, not emitting X-rays: https://en.wikipedia.org/wiki/Cathode-ray_tube Blasting X-rays through a screen to the face of an observer would not have been a good idea…

X-rays are mentioned 28 times in the Wikipedia link about CRTs, https://en.wikipedia.org/wiki/Cathode-ray_tube

Although X-rays are not used to draw the image, they are generated as an unwanted side effect. The phosphorescent screen emits X-rays when struck by the electron beam. To protect the user, the glass must be a special kind of glass to absorb those X-rays, and the accelerator voltage has to be set not too high.
